"I don't know anything about it." "But you just said-----" At that moment came a cry through the dark woods: "Shep! Shep! where are you? Go back to the raft! It is all right---we have the outfit back! Go back to the raft!" It was Snap who was calling, and in another minute he appeared and confronted the crowd that was holding Shep a prisoner. CHAPTER XXIII THE LOSS OF THE RAFT It was so dark under the trees that for the moment Snap did not recognize his chum. Then he uttered an exclamation of commingled wonder and alarm. "Let go of him!" he cried. "Let go, I say!" and he caught Ham Spink by the arm. "Capture him, fellows!" shouted Carl Dudder, and at once several of the Spink crowd fell upon Snap. |
